Building Materials Store Services in Sedgefield, Western Cape
In Sedgefield, Western Cape, building materials stores function as practical hubs for both DIY enthusiasts and professional tradespeople. They stock a broad range of products essential for construction, renovation and maintenance projects, occupying a vital role in supporting the local built environment. Stores in this region typically balance a large, accessible retail floor with specialised departments, aimed at providing immediate access to commonly used items while guiding customers toward more technical or bespoke solutions.
Customers can expect a core offering that covers construction essentials, including cement and aggregates, bricks and blocks, timber and sheet material, roofing products, and a selection of plaster, paint and finishing supplies. Electrical and plumbing sections are commonly present, catering to wiring accessories, fittings, fasteners, fittings and pipework. Hardware and tools, from hand tools to power tools and safety equipment, are usually available to support both small-scale repairs and larger instalment tasks. The range often extends to basic landscaping materials, drainage solutions and insulation products, reflecting the needs of homes and small businesses in the area.
Practical services commonly offered include assistance with product selection, technical advice on materials compatibility, and guidance on installation considerations. Staff with practical trade knowledge can help estimate quantities, explain material properties, and suggest suitable alternatives based on project requirements and budget. For more complex needs, stores may facilitate order-in options for non-standard sizes or items not kept in stock, with lead times advised at the point of enquiry.
Delivery is a critical service for many customers in and around Sedgefield. Stores typically provide local delivery to residential and commercial sites, with arrangements for bulk orders or heavy materials such as timber, roofing sheets or concrete products. In some cases, customers can arrange collection from the store or a nearby depot, which can help manage time and transportation challenges for smaller projects. Delivery scheduling is commonly coordinated to suit site access, route restrictions, and the availability of personnel on the project site.
Financing and account arrangements are often available for regular customers, builders, or tradespeople. Trade accounts may provide extended payment terms, bulk pricing, and a convenient way to manage recurring purchases. Loyalty schemes or promotions are frequently offered on seasonal products or widely used essentials such as paints, sealants, and hardware. It is usual to see a clear refund or return policy on unopened items, with appropriate documentation required for exchanges or credits.
To support project planning, many stores offer additional practical services. These can include cut-to-size or custom cutting of timber and sheet materials, aided by nearby machinery and experienced staff. Some locations provide tool hire for specialised tasks, enabling customers to access equipment without the full investment of ownership. Project planning advice, layout considerations, and guidance on building regulations or local best practices may be available informally through customer service desks or dedicated trade counters.
Health and safety considerations play a central role in everyday operations. Stores emphasise safe handling of materials, the use of personal protective equipment, and clear guidance on the proper storage of hazardous or moisture-sensitive items. Maintaining clean, well-organised aisles and clearly labelled product ranges helps customers locate items quickly, reducing unnecessary handling and waste. Environmental considerations, such as recycling packaging and offering sustainable alternatives, are increasingly part of the store’s approach to business in the Western Cape.
Overall, building materials stores in Sedgefield provide a practical, customer-focused service model designed to support a diverse community of builders, renovators and homeowners. By combining a wide product range with accessible advice, reliable delivery, and flexible purchase options, these stores aim to help projects progress smoothly from initial planning through to completion.
